Vue.js 相对他框架的优势_清晰文档_它的语法简单就像写HTML一样新手也能很快上手

Vue.js 相对其他框架的优势

一、易上手

Vue.js 是个简单易懂的前端框架,学起来不费劲。它的语法简单,就像写HTML一样,新手也能很快上手。

举个例子,创建一个简单的Vue实例,只需要几行代码:




// 创建一个Vue实例

var vm = new Vue({

  el: '#app',

  data: {

    message: 'Hello Vue!'

  }

});



二、性能优秀

Vue.js在性能上很出色,主要体现在以下几点:

性能测试显示,Vue.js在处理大量动态数据时,通常比其他框架(如Angular和React)更快。

三、灵活性和可扩展性强

Vue.js提供了高度灵活性和可扩展性,开发者可以根据需求定制和扩展:

比如,使用Vue Router可以实现单页面应用的路由管理:




// 引入Vue Router

import VueRouter from 'vue-router';



// 创建Vue实例

var router = new VueRouter({

  routes: [

    { path: '/', component: Home },

    { path: '/about', component: About }

  ]

});



new Vue({

  router

}).$mount('#app');



四、良好的生态系统和社区支持

Vue.js拥有庞大活跃的社区,提供了丰富的资源和支持:

比如,Element是一个基于Vue.js的组件库,提供了丰富的UI组件,方便快速搭建界面:




// 引入Element UI

import ElementUI from 'element-ui';



// 创建Vue实例

new Vue({

  el: '#app',

  components: { ElButton }

}).$mount('#app');



Vue.js的易上手、性能优秀、灵活性和可扩展性、良好的生态系统和社区支持,使其成为许多开发者的首选前端框架。选择Vue.js,根据项目需求和技术背景,可以做出最佳决策。

相关问答FAQs

问题 回答
为什么选择Vue而不是其他框架? Vue的设计理念是渐进式的,易于上手,响应式设计高效,组件化开发方便,轻量级且社区活跃。
Vue相对于React的优势有哪些? Vue的学习曲线更平缓,数据绑定更直观,组件化开发更简单,生态系统更丰富。
Vue相对于Angular的优势有哪些? Vue的学习曲线更平缓,性能更优秀,组件化开发更简单,生态系统更丰富。